O R D E R
This Criminal Original Petition has been filed seeking a direction to the 3rd respondent to complete the investigation and to file the final report in Crime No. 1385 of 2017 dated 17.06.2017 pending on the file of the respondent police.
2. By consent of both sides, this Criminal Original Petition is taken up for disposal.
3.Whenever any information in relation to commission of cognizable or non cognizable offence is received, the police officer shall adhere to the procedure contemplated under Sections 154 & 155 of the Criminal Procedure Code and after https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/
conducting necessary enquiry/investigation, file final report under Section 173 of Cr.P.C. Such investigation under Chapter XII of the Criminal Procedure Code shall be completed without any unnecessary delay. The delay in filing a final report in the present case is inordinate and unjustified. Hence, it would be appropriate to direct the Investigating Officer to file a final report within a stipulated time, if not already filed. 4.Considering the facts and circumstance of the case, this Court directs the 3rd respondent police to complete the investigation in Crime No. 1385 of 2017 dated 17.06.2017 pending on his file and file a final report within a period of eight we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order. This Criminal Original Petition is disposed of accordingly. Sd/- Assistant Registrar(CS IX) //True Copy// Sub Assistant Registrar ak To 1.The Joint Commissioner of Police, Ambattur, Chennai.
